Output bbafa717ecf045b024b6bc956dc34ba05b14d5913c66548a64cfdc2d4e8b7063:2

value
1189805
script pubkey
OP_0 OP_PUSHBYTES_20 76b397d01105c1777a722f42e7326cd346a6ae4a
address
bc1qw6ee05q3qhqhw7nj9apwwvnv6dr2dtj297jdh8
transaction
bbafa717ecf045b024b6bc956dc34ba05b14d5913c66548a64cfdc2d4e8b7063
confirmations
134787
spent
true